Experimental tests of the modernized VASSILISSA separator (SHELS) with the use of accelerated 50Ti ions
Description
High-intensity ion beam of 50Ti ions was obtained using ECR ion source at the U400 cyclotron. The experimental tests using accelerated 50Ti ions were performed with modernized VASSILISSA separator (SHELS). Data have been obtained on the transmission coefficients of recoil nuclei synthesized in complete fusion reactions. Estimates from ion optical calculations performed in the design phase of the project of modernization of the separator are completely confirmed.
